Transaction 1fbab34fbf6c9926b3694f34475395b82cb76a83eced74a93e1da33a855991a3
1 Input
1 Output
-
1fbab34fbf6c9926b3694f34475395b82cb76a83eced74a93e1da33a855991a3:0
- value
- 4594822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b908329b9a81f31455620c30e9ad758e7c91623 OP_EQUAL
- address
- 377xukpDeqxgwpwYEX6qo5XeNRjiC3HQdq